About this property

Secluded but Not Remote, Private Retreat

Please note before booking:
We CANNOT accept typical refundable deposits.
Instead we require the $59.00 property damage protection policy (aka PDP).

Private hot tub, Large deck, 40 inch flat screen TV with built in apps, Blu-Ray DVD player with built in apps, wireless high speed internet (no satellite or cable though), and washer and dryer. You'll also find a fully stocked kitchen with vintage china and everything you need. The 900 sf cabin is beautifully decorated with folk art and antiques and has a large library of mystery novels for young and old. Outside there is a very large wrap around deck with tables and chairs.

The water may smell like Sulphur. It is natural magnesium that is common in well water. It is not harmful. Running the water for short while will eliminate the smell.

What makes this property unique

This home is the definition of cozy and, in this case, it's not just a euphemism for small. There are large comfortable sofas, skylights in the living and dining area, a wood stove that will heat the entire home and lots of peace and quiet. It's a perfect place for that Romantic retreat, or a place to park yourself and work on that novel, or to sit in quiet contemplation or use as a base of operations for the many outdoor activities available in the area.
